Advanced Dental Technologies
Dentists in Victoria Point often utilise cutting-edge technologies to improve the quality of dental care. Digital X-rays significantly reduce radiation exposure compared to traditional X-rays and provide clearer images for accurate diagnosis. Intraoral cameras allow for detailed images of the mouth, helping in the detection of issues that might be missed during a standard examination. CAD/CAM technology is increasingly popular for creating crowns, bridges, and veneers, offering precise and speedy restorations.
Laser dentistry can be used for various treatments, including gum reshaping and cavity removal, providing a more comfortable experience with reduced healing time. Advanced sterilisation equipment ensures a hygienic environment, minimising the risk of infections. Practices may also offer 3D imaging for comprehensive assessments and treatment planning, particularly useful for implants and orthodontics. Such technologies not only enhance the accuracy of treatments but also contribute to a more efficient and less invasive dental experience.

Emergency Dental Services
Dental emergencies can be alarming and require swift action to address pain and prevent further complications. In Victoria Point, dental practices often provide urgent care for various emergencies to ensure immediate relief and treatment.
Common emergencies include knocked-out teeth, severe toothaches, chipped or broken teeth, and abscesses. It’s crucial to contact your dentist as soon as possible in such situations. Immediate action, like preserving a knocked-out tooth in milk or a tooth-saving solution, can significantly increase the chances of successful reimplantation.
Many practices offer same-day appointments for emergency cases, prioritising patients with urgent needs. If you’re experiencing severe pain or discomfort, do not hesitate to reach out to your dentist, who can offer prompt solutions, including pain relief, temporary restorations, or even emergency root canals.
Some dental practices in Victoria Point have specific protocols for handling emergencies, such as after-hours contact numbers and designated emergency slots in their schedules. Knowing your dentist’s emergency procedures beforehand can be very helpful.
For situations where you cannot see your dentist immediately, temporary measures like over-the-counter pain relief and cold compresses can help manage discomfort. However, these are not substitutes for professional dental care and should only be used as interim solutions until you can receive appropriate treatment from your dentist.
